This is a drawing of an industrial scene. The image shows two figures engaged in loading or unloading activities beside a haulage truck, with boxes and items surrounding them. The background features an urban setting with buildings and what seems to be a clock tower or spire. The textures and details in the drawing, such as wood grain on crates and fabric folds on clothing, add richness to the scene. The play of light and shadow creates depth in the image.
